Exploring into the Quantum World: An Introduction

The quantum world is a realm of extraordinary phenomena that confounds our everyday intuition. At its core, quantum mechanics describes the behavior of matter and energy at the atomic and subatomic levels. Unlike the classical world, where objects have definite properties, quantum entities exist in a state of probability, meaning they can be in multiple states simultaneously until measured. This intriguing concept has led to many groundbreaking discoveries and technological advancements, such as lasers, transistors, and atomic computers.

To begin our journey into this enigmatic realm, we'll investigate some of the fundamental principles of quantum mechanics. We'll discover concepts like wave-particle duality, correlation, and the uncertainty principle, which reveal the novel nature of reality at its most basic level.
